2010-06-15 38 views
0

我只是對官方FIFA網站的設計和開發感到好奇。國際足聯官方網站設計與開發

  1. 什麼是編程語言 被用來建立網站?
  2. 他們使用的開發方法是什麼?

我用螢火蟲來看看周圍的site.Here的......我發現:

HTTP/1.1 200 OK 
Cache-Control: no-store, no-cache, must-revalidate, private 
Content-Type: text/html 
Server: Microsoft-IIS/7.0 
x-ua-compatible: IE=EmulateIE7 
Vary: Accept-Encoding 
Content-Length: 8320 
Date: Tue, 15 Jun 2010 17:54:19 GMT 
Connection: keep-alive 

根據,我認爲他們使用IIS 7運行的網站,但我不知道什麼編程語言他們正在使用。

任何評論都是杯中的一滴水。

回答

1

很難說,因爲他們模糊了文件擴展名,但即使它們不是擴展名也不會意味着什麼(例如,我可以將php站點配置爲使用.aspx擴展名)。然而,只要跳過他們的代碼,我可以告訴你他們至少使用jQuery來處理一些客戶端的東西。

如果我不得不猜測,我會說他們使用ASP.NET,但這只是一個猜測。我這樣說是因爲我認爲它會更可能成爲一些基於Windows的平臺,否則他們可能會使用Linux。當然,這不是一個給定的。我只是說,因爲Linux是免費的,如果你只是要使用像PHP或Java這樣的跨平臺技術,那麼投資Windows授權是沒有意義的。也就是說,成本並不是選擇服務器平臺的唯一選擇,因爲完全有可能他們的IT員工知道Windows,而他們的開發人員只知道Java而不瞭解Linux。

此外,看代碼,它看起來不是以人性化的方式編寫的,除了在<script></script>標籤之間出現的內容之外。這至少會提示某種「編譯」語言,比如ASP.NET的自定義標記(即<asp:label>),其中有一些自定義jQuery由人類拋出。然而,這只是猜測(想想那些哲學家們觸摸大象的不同部分,並且他們每個人都認爲它是不同的動物)的諺語。

所以,就像我說的那樣,很難確定,但這是我的分析。 確實知道它寫的是與開發人員交談的唯一方法。我很好奇這個網站上的人是否有比我能夠提供的更強的分析。

+0

是的..他們使用jQuery和Flash ..除了我還不知道。 – Narazana 2010-06-15 18:24:23